Interview by Kris PetersMelbourne metal outfit Munt could easily lay claim to being one of the most brutal acts this country has produced. Their music is frenetic, dangerous, aggressive and strangely beautiful - to the point that despite the visceral carnage going on around you, you can't help but be swept up in the sonic musical landscape as it materialises and then disintegrates right before your ears.They are a formidable live machine - as anyone who has been in the same room as them with a stage anywhere near the vicinity can attest - but seldom does a band capture the feel and essence of the live arena as meticulously as these guys.As if to prove the point, Munt today drop their third EP Pain Ouroboros, five carefully crafted slabs of musical mayhem that obliterate the lines of traditional metal, in the process morphing into something much more sinister.HEAVY caught up with frontman Mothlord earlier this week to talk about the EP, starting with the last single released Apostate Sermon."An apostate, by the dictionary definition, is someone who defies or rejects religion in a political way of thinking," he measured. "And obviously a sermon is... I guess it's like a paradox. A sermon would be something you think of in a religious context , but instead it's a sermon for people who've shed that skin so to speak. The opening line is "my brethren I sing a song of joyful wrath", so it's kind of a call to arms and a message for like minded people."Apostate Sermon follows on from the first single The Vengeful March, so we press Mothlord on if those two tracks are a good sonic representation of the EP as a whole."Oh, yeah," he replied without thought. "I think we very intentionally chose those two songs to do music videos for. Like I said, Apostate's a bit more of the blackened epic sound, whereas The Vengeful March is a little bit more in the class of hard hitting, grindy sound of things. It's a very good representation of what we're about at the moment."In the full interview. Matt Henry has made the most of a rare test chance, firing the Black Caps into control on the opening day of the first test against South Africa in Christchurch. Revelling in green conditions on his home ground of Hagley Oval, Christchurch seamer Henry was nearly unplayable. His figures of seven-for-23 are bettered by just two other New Zealand bowlers in a test innings. South Africa were skittled for just 95 and New Zealand reached 116 for three by stumps. GREGORY GALLOWAY chats to Paul Burke about his new novel JUST THIEVES, identity, fatalism and existential questions in the noir novel, Chandler, Cain and Get Carter.JUST THIEVES: Rick and Frank are recovering addicts and accomplished house thieves whose partnership extends beyond their professional lives. They do not steal randomly they steal according to order, hired by a mysterious handler. The jobs run routinely until they're tasked with taking a seemingly worthless trophy: an object that generates interest and obsession out of proportion to its apparent value. Just as the robbery is completed, the two are involved in a freak car accident that sets off a chain of events and Frank disappears with the trophy. As Rick tries to find Frank, he is forced to confront his past, upending both his livelihood and his sense of reality. The narrative builds steadily into a powerful and shocking climax. Revelling in its con-artistry and double-crosses, Just Thieves is a nail-biting, noir-ish exploration of the working lives of two unforgettable crooks and the hidden forces that rule and ruin their lives. GREGORY GALLOWAY is the author of the novels The 39 Deaths of Adam Strand and the Alex Award-winning As Simple As Snow. His short stories have appeared in the Rush Hour and Taking Aim anthologies. MA chats with former leading figure of WImbledon's "Crazy Gang" of the 1980's and 1990's, John Fashanu. Part of the now defunct London club's famous F.A. Cup triumph in 1988, Fashanu has led a fascinating an often controversial life, which has seen him go from one of the hardest players in the English game, to a regular fixture on our TV screens which included the former England international presenting the hit show Gladiators over twenty years ago.Key to the development of Fashanu's character, a man who many have described as a 'bully", is his complex childhood. Having been placed into a Barnardo's home with his older brother Justin as a baby, the pair soon found themselves in the Foster care of a rural white family in Norfolk, where being the only black kids in town made them targets for racial prejudice. With this came an ambition to succeed however, and having followed in the footsteps of his often envied older brother who became Britain's first £1 million pound black footballer, Fashanu found his path through the beautiful game. Revelling in the unconventional methods of the ruthless but equally successful Wimbledon side, Fashanu became a household name in the English game, with his ability to intimidate being as responsible as his technical gifts. Throughout this career however, there was something that lay much deeper for "Fash". With his brother becoming the world's first professional footballer to come out as gay, bigotry and hate was par for the course, in a game that refused to recognise such a sexual leaning. Admittedly playing his part in societies ostracisation of his brother, Fashanu was rocked in 1998 when the once brightest prospect in English football was found hanged in a garage in Shoreditch. With maturity and age, Fashanu opens up on his regrets about past events in his life in this episode of The Michael Anthony Show, and also delves into a career that lives long in the memory of football fans worldwide. His career in entertainment is also discussed, as is footballs still dubious relationship with homosexuality. Kirsty Young's castaway this week is the comedian, Sarah Millican. Her every woman yet no-holds-barred style of comedy has brought her sell-out tours and several of her own highly successful TV series. Revelling in normality and drawing on the difficult, intimate and often excruciating moments of being human, she dares to say what most of us are thinking, only she's much funnier. A Geordie, born in South Shields, her dad was an engineer down the mines and her mum was a hairdresser. They encouraged their daughter in her storytelling and performing even though her childhood shyness meant she'd recite her poetry from behind the living room curtains. Later it was pain that first propelled her onto the stage when a broken early marriage provided the catalyst she needed to find the courage to confront the glaring judgement of the audience's gaze. Her rise was then rapid. Within four years she was awarded the Best Newcomer prize at the Edinburgh Fringe. She says, "People come along and think, 'oh she's being too rude'. They don't realise I'm just like this at home. People think I'm prim and proper at home but I'm not - I'm just me transplanted onto the stage". Producer: Cathy Drysdale.
